Samsung Selects Atmel’s New Sensor Hub Solution for Galaxy Note II

SAN JOSE, CA, November 26, 2012—Atmel® Corporation (NASDAQ: ATML), a leader in microcontroller  and touch technology solutions, today announced Samsung has selected Atmel’s AVR UC3L microcontroller with patented ultra-low power picoPower technology as its sensor hub management solution for the recently launched Galaxy Note II.

Powered by a 1.6GHz quad-core processor, Samsung’s Galaxy Note II runs on Android’s 4.1 operating system (also known as Jelly Bean), and offers a 5.5-inch, high-definition super AMOLED display with 1,280 x 720 resolution.

The Galaxy Note II includes several sensors that detect motion, including an accelerometer, RGB light, digital compass, proximity, gyro and barometer, and are ideal for a range of applications including gaming, navigation and virtual reality. Atmel’s AVR UC3L sensor hub solution combines the input from these multiple sensors to provide real-time direction, orientation and inclination data to deliver superior performance, in addition to lower power consumption to achieve longer battery life.
